New Walmart CEO John Furner Takes Over as Doug McMillon Retires

After a successful tenure as the CEO of Walmart, Doug McMillon has announced his retirement. Stepping into his shoes is John Furner, who has been with the company for over 25 years and has a strong track record of leadership and innovation.

A Smooth Transition

McMillon’s retirement comes at a time when Walmart is facing significant challenges and opportunities in the retail industry. As the world’s largest retailer, Walmart has been at the forefront of digital transformation and e-commerce, and McMillon has played a key role in driving the company’s growth and success in these areas.

With Furner taking over as CEO, Walmart is poised to continue its momentum and build on its strong foundation. Furner has a deep understanding of the company’s operations and culture, having worked in various roles across the organization. His experience and vision will be crucial in guiding Walmart through the next phase of its evolution.
